At its core, is a story about the bond between two brothers and the external forces that tear them apart. The film stars Mithun Chakraborty and Saif Ali Khan as the primary leads. Mithun plays Shanker, a man framed for a crime he didn’t commit, while Saif plays Jai, the younger brother caught in a web of deception.
